Job DetailsLevel: ExperiencedJob Location: Harrison, NY 10528Position Type: Full TimeEducation Level: BachelorsSalary Range: $31.95 - $39.95 HourlyTravel Percentage: Up to 50% Job Shift: VariedJob Category: Health CareWeekly Game/Treatment Hours: ~ 22.5 hours of Sports Coverage, 17.5 hours of PT Clinic Coverage as a PT Tech Location: Harrison ONS Physical Therapy Clinic & Iona University Position: Full time; 40 hours/week Days: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day Thursday, Friday, Saturday   Who We Are:  Spire Orthopedic Partners is a growing national partnership of orthopedic practices that provides the support, capital and operational resources physicians need to grow thriving practices for the future. As a Management Services Organization (MSO), Spire provides the infrastructure for administrative operations that allows practices to operate at their highest level, so doctors can focus their efforts on what matters most – patient care. Headquartered in Stamford, Connecticut, the Spire network spans the Northeast with more than 165 physicians, 1,800 employees, 285 other clinical providers and 40 locations in New York, Connecticut, Rhode Island and Massachusetts.    What you’ll do:  As an Athletic Trainer working with Orthopaedic & Neurosurgery Specialists (ONS) and in partnership with the Iona University Club Rugby, responsibilities as noted below: Responsibilities/Duties:  Evaluates athletes’ physical conditions and advises and treats players to maintain maximum physical fitness for participation in athletic competition.  Prescribes routine and corrective exercises to strengthen muscles.  Performs manual and soft tissue techniques to alleviate pain, restore function/motion and diminish edema.  Utilizes taping, wrapping/strapping techniques to prevent and help support injured areas.  Uses modalities as appropriate for patient care.  Renders emergency management and first aid to injured players, including but not limited to giving artificial respiration, cleaning and bandaging wounds, splinting, immobilizing and spine boarding Works with physicians to provide a continuum of care to patients.  Confers with physical therapy team members individually and in conference to exchange, discuss, and evaluate player information for planning, modifying and coordinating treatment programs.  Maintains accurate documentation of care of players in EMR.  Maintains work area in a clean and orderly fashion.  Assist with administration of pre-participation and exit physicals  Acts as a liaison with the team physician and ONS physicians to refer athletes for evaluation and diagnostic imaging when warranted  Coordinates formal Physical Therapy, imaging, and follow-up appointments for athletes with allied healthcare professionals  Set-up and breakdown of all athletic training supplies needed for practices/games  Communication with coaches regarding treatment plan for injuries and adequate injury prevention  Determines if a player is capable of continued participation in a game and/or practice if the player is injured  Organizes, inventories, and requisitions medical team and team supplies.  Performs other duties as needed Performs duties as assigned in the Physical Therapy Clinic: Maintains cleanliness of treatment tables, equipment and gym area Expedites patients to/from treatment areas, sets ups modalities like cold laser, hot packs and cold packs Stocks treatment areas daily, assists in inventory supply Works directly with Physical and Occupational Therapist to ensure proper execution of Therapeutic Exercise Follows all HIPAA rules as instructed.  Follows ONS’ policies and procedures.    QualificationsWho you are:  Bachelor’s degree in athletic training or equivalent.  Holds valid NATA certification/license for athletic trainer in CT/NY State  Minimum one year experience as athletic trainer.  Excellent verbal and written communication skills.  Strong interpersonal and customer service skills.    What we offer:   Excellent growth and advancement opportunities   Dynamic environment   Access to a diverse network of practitioners   Broad infrastructure of tools and programs to enhance the employee experience      Competitive Compensation     We are an equal-opportunity employer.
